Transaction 262dac71aaaad30567be1b57ef3675a62190ea1234f6242310218f15bea52db1

8 Input
2 Outputs
  • 262dac71aaaad30567be1b57ef3675a62190ea1234f6242310218f15bea52db1:0
  • value  18183497
    address  3Ng7M18smZxhVitVegxHEoSmPi8WGb5SrJ
  • 262dac71aaaad30567be1b57ef3675a62190ea1234f6242310218f15bea52db1:1
  • value  368208
    address  35DS3SGuRM8CqhDrwXgtCQez48ciaK6Hok